彻底解决Clash配置到期问题:从原理到实践的完整指南

看看资讯 / 117人浏览
注意:免费节点订阅链接已更新至 2026-05-01点击查看详情

引言:当代理工具成为数字生活的刚需

在当今高度互联的世界中,网络访问自由已成为数字公民的基本需求。无论是跨境学术研究、国际商务沟通,还是获取全球资讯,代理工具都扮演着关键角色。Clash作为一款开源、跨平台的代理客户端,以其模块化设计和规则系统的灵活性,成为技术爱好者首选的网络解决方案。然而,"配置到期"这个看似简单的提示,却可能让用户的网络访问戛然而止。本文将深入剖析这一问题的技术本质,提供一套从诊断到修复的完整方案,并分享高级用户的维护技巧。

第一章 理解Clash配置系统的运作机制

1.1 订阅链接的生命周期

Clash的核心在于其配置文件订阅系统。不同于传统VPN的静态配置,现代代理服务普遍采用动态订阅模式——用户获得的不是一个永久有效的服务器列表,而是一个会定期更新的"活文档"。这种设计既保障了服务商能够轮换被封锁的节点,也要求客户端具备持续更新的能力。典型的订阅链接有效期从7天到30天不等,过期后若未及时更新,就会出现"配置到期"的警告。

1.2 配置验证的时间戳原理

深入代码层面会发现,Clash在加载配置文件时会检查两个关键时间参数:expires字段表示的绝对过期时间,以及interval字段建议的更新频率。有趣的是,某些客户端实现会采用"宽松模式"和"严格模式"两种时间校验策略,前者允许过期配置继续使用(仅提示警告),后者则直接阻断连接。这种差异常导致不同用户面对同一问题的不同表现。

第二章 配置到期问题的五大根源诊断

2.1 订阅服务的"心跳停止"

2023年第三季度的用户统计显示,约42%的配置问题源于订阅服务本身的异常。包括但不限于:
- 服务商更换了订阅系统但未通知用户
- 付费订阅未及时续费导致权限失效
- 服务端遭遇DDoS攻击或服务器迁移

诊断技巧:使用curl命令直接请求订阅链接,观察返回内容是否包含有效的节点信息:
bash curl -s "您的订阅链接" | head -n 20

2.2 客户端的时间悖论

笔者曾遇到一个典型案例:用户系统时间停留在2020年,导致SSL证书验证失败的同时,Clash将未来到期的配置误判为已过期。这种"时空错乱"现象在以下情况尤为常见:
- 虚拟机/容器内未正确同步宿主机时间
- 双系统用户切换OS后未调整BIOS时钟
- 使用某些修改版ROM导致NTP服务异常

2.3 网络环境的隐形屏障

企业网络或校园网中,深度包检测(DPI)设备可能:
- 拦截对订阅域名的DNS查询
- 重置包含proxy关键词的HTTPS连接
- 限制外部配置文件下载的带宽

高级技巧:通过traceroute和mtr工具分析到订阅服务器的网络路径,检查是否存在中间节点丢包。

第三章 系统化的解决方案矩阵

3.1 订阅链接的复活术(分步图解)

  1. 基础验证:在浏览器隐私模式访问订阅链接,观察是否返回yaml/yml文件
  2. 缓存清除:删除~/.config/clash/cache目录下的临时文件
  3. 链接转换:使用第三方订阅转换服务(需谨慎选择可信服务)
  4. 协议切换:尝试将订阅链接从HTTPS改为SS/SSR协议(如有提供)

3.2 时间同步的工程级修正

对于Linux用户推荐采用chrony替代传统ntpd:
bash sudo chronyc -a 'burst 4/4' && sudo chronyc -a makestep Windows用户应检查注册表中HKEY_LOCAL_MACHINE\SYSTEM\CurrentControlSet\Services\W32Time\Config的AnnounceFlags值是否为5。

3.3 客户端的深度调优

在Clash的配置文件中添加以下参数可增强稳定性:
yaml profile: store-selected: true # 记住最后使用的节点 store-fake-ip: true # 防止DNS污染导致更新失败 tun: enable: true # 启用增强模式绕过某些网络限制

第四章 预防性维护体系构建

4.1 自动化监控方案

使用Python脚本+Telegram Bot实现:
- 每日自动验证订阅链接有效性
- 配置文件变更diff对比
- 到期前72小时推送提醒

4.2 冗余配置策略

资深用户应该维护:
1. 主用订阅(付费高质量线路)
2. 备用订阅(免费或低质量线路)
3. 本地静态配置(应急基础节点)

4.3 版本管理的艺术

建议使用Git管理配置文件历史版本:
bash git init && git add config.yaml git commit -m "2024-03配置快照"

第五章 超越工具本身的技术思考

Clash配置问题本质上是分布式系统可靠性的微观体现。从CAP理论视角看,用户需要在一致性(立即获取最新配置)、可用性(持续提供服务)和分区容错性(网络不稳定时的表现)之间做出权衡。真正优雅的解决方案不在于频繁更换工具,而在于建立对网络自由本质的理解——这既是技术挑战,也是数字时代公民意识的体现。

终极建议:将本文所述方法封装为Docker容器,实现一键式自愈系统。当检测到配置异常时,自动轮换订阅源、校验时间服务、生成诊断报告。这种基础设施即代码(IaC)的思路,才是应对网络环境持续恶化的根本之道。


语言艺术点评
本文突破了传统技术指南的平铺直叙,通过"问题诊断-解决方案-预防体系"的三段式结构,构建了完整的技术叙事。巧妙运用军事术语(如"冗余配置")、哲学概念("时间悖论")和计算机理论(CAP定理),使枯燥的代理配置问题升华为对网络自由的系统性思考。文中穿插的代码片段和技术细节,既保证了专业性,又通过比喻(如"心跳停止")降低了理解门槛。特别是将版本控制、自动化监控等DevOps实践引入个人网络工具维护,体现了技术写作的前瞻性。这种既有实操步骤又有理论深度的写作手法,正是优秀技术内容的核心特征。

掌握v2rayng同步艺术:从入门到精通的完整指南

在这个信息自由流动的时代,网络访问工具已成为数字生活的重要组成部分。作为Android平台上广受欢迎的代理客户端,v2rayng以其强大的功能和灵活的配置选项赢得了众多用户的青睐。本文将深入探讨v2rayng的核心功能之一——同步机制,帮助您在不同设备间无缝迁移配置,实现高效便捷的网络管理体验。

v2rayng:您的数字自由之门

v2rayng是基于V2Ray核心开发的Android客户端应用,它不仅仅是一个简单的VPN工具,更是一个功能全面的网络代理解决方案。与同类应用相比,v2rayng最大的优势在于其高度可定制化的特性,用户可以根据自身需求调整各种参数,实现最优的网络访问体验。

这款应用的诞生源于对网络自由的追求,它能够帮助用户突破地域限制,访问全球范围内的网络资源。无论是学术研究、商业情报收集,还是简单的社交媒体浏览,v2rayng都能提供稳定可靠的连接服务。特别值得一提的是,它支持多种协议,包括VMess、VLESS、Shadowsocks等,这种多样性确保了在不同网络环境下的兼容性和稳定性。

同步功能:v2rayng的智能桥梁

v2rayng的同步功能是其最受用户欢迎的特性之一,它解决了多设备间配置迁移的痛点。想象一下,当您更换新手机或需要在平板电脑上使用相同配置时,传统的重新配置过程既耗时又容易出错。而v2rayng的同步功能则完美解决了这一问题,让配置迁移变得轻松简单。

同步功能的核心价值在于其多样化的实现方式。用户可以根据具体场景选择最适合的同步方法:二维码扫描适合面对面的快速共享;链接分享便于远程协作;手动输入则为高级用户提供了完全控制的可能。这种灵活性使得v2rayng能够适应各种使用场景,从个人使用到团队协作都能游刃有余。

二维码同步:科技带来的便捷

二维码同步是v2rayng中最直观、最便捷的同步方式。其操作流程设计得极为人性化:在源设备上生成包含配置信息的二维码,然后在目标设备上扫描即可完成同步。这种方法省去了繁琐的手动输入过程,大大降低了配置错误的可能性。

在实际应用中,二维码同步特别适合以下场景:当您需要为家人或朋友的设备快速配置相同的网络参数时;当您自己更换设备希望保留原有设置时;或者在小型团队中需要统一网络配置时。整个过程通常只需几秒钟,真正实现了"一扫即用"的便捷体验。

值得一提的是,v2rayng的二维码生成机制采用了高效的编码方式,即使是复杂的配置信息也能被压缩到一个标准的二维码中。同时,应用还提供了二维码预览功能,确保生成的图像清晰可读,避免因图像质量问题导致扫描失败的情况。

导入导出:传统而可靠的同步方式

对于偏好传统方法的用户,v2rayng提供了完整的导入导出功能。这种方式虽然不如二维码同步那样"炫酷",但在某些场景下却更为实用。例如,当您需要备份重要配置以防设备丢失时;或者当您希望将配置分享给无法当面接触的人时,文件导入导出就成为理想选择。

导出配置的过程极为简单:在应用内选择目标配置,点击导出按钮,系统会生成一个包含所有必要信息的配置文件。这个文件可以被存储在设备本地,也可以上传至云盘或发送给其他用户。v2rayng支持多种文件格式,确保了与其他设备的兼容性。

导入过程同样直观:用户只需选择之前导出的配置文件,应用会自动解析并应用其中的设置。这种方法特别适合批量配置多台设备,或者在不同品牌Android设备间迁移设置。值得注意的是,导入过程中应用会提示用户确认操作,避免意外覆盖现有配置的风险。

同步中的常见问题与解决方案

即使是设计精良的功能,在实际使用中也可能遇到各种问题。v2rayng的同步功能虽然可靠,但用户仍可能遇到一些典型问题。了解这些问题及其解决方法,将帮助您更顺利地使用这一强大功能。

配置冲突是最常见的问题之一,当两台设备上的配置存在差异时,同步可能导致意外结果。解决这一问题的关键在于同步前确认双方配置的一致性,或者在必要时选择覆盖式同步。v2rayng在这方面提供了清晰的提示和选项,帮助用户做出明智选择。

同步后连接失败是另一个可能遇到的问题。这通常是由于网络环境变化或配置参数不匹配导致的。解决方法包括:检查网络连接状态、验证服务器信息是否正确、确认订阅链接是否有效等。v2rayng内置的诊断工具可以帮助用户快速定位问题根源。

安全与隐私:同步中的不可忽视要素

在进行配置同步时,安全性和隐私保护是必须考虑的重要因素。v2rayng在设计同步功能时充分考虑了这些方面,采取了多种措施保障用户数据安全。

二维码同步虽然便捷,但在公共场所使用时需警惕"偷窥"风险。建议在生成二维码后尽快完成扫描,避免长时间暴露配置信息。对于包含敏感信息的配置,最好在可信环境中进行同步操作。

文件导入导出方式则需要注意文件存储的安全性。建议将配置文件存储在加密的云盘或本地加密文件夹中,避免未经授权的访问。同时,分享配置文件链接时应设置合理的有效期和访问权限,防止信息泄露。

高级同步技巧与最佳实践

掌握了基本同步方法后,让我们探讨一些提升效率的高级技巧和最佳实践。这些经验来自于长期用户的实践总结,能够帮助您更好地利用v2rayng的同步功能。

定期备份配置是一个好习惯。您可以设置自动任务,每周将重要配置导出到安全位置。这样即使设备丢失或损坏,也能快速恢复网络访问能力。

对于团队使用场景,建议建立一个标准配置模板,然后通过链接分享方式统一分发。这种方法确保了所有成员使用相同的优化设置,减少了因配置差异导致的技术支持需求。

考虑使用第三方工具增强同步体验。例如,结合自动化应用可以实现配置的定时更新和同步;使用安全的文件共享服务可以简化团队协作流程。v2rayng的开放性使其能够很好地融入各种工作流程。

v2rayng同步功能的未来展望

随着技术发展,v2rayng的同步功能有望变得更加强大和智能。我们可以期待以下可能的改进方向:

跨平台同步将是一个重要发展方向。目前v2rayng主要面向Android设备,未来可能实现与iOS、Windows等平台的配置互通,真正实现"一次配置,处处可用"的愿景。

云同步功能也值得期待。通过安全的云端存储,用户可以随时随地访问自己的最新配置,无需担心设备更换或丢失带来的不便。

智能冲突解决机制将提升用户体验。当检测到配置差异时,系统可以提供更智能的合并建议,甚至根据使用习惯自动选择最优配置。

结语:掌握同步,释放v2rayng全部潜能

v2rayng的同步功能看似简单,实则蕴含着提升网络使用效率的巨大潜力。通过本文的详细介绍,您已经了解了从基础操作到高级技巧的全面知识。无论是个人用户还是团队管理员,合理利用这些同步方法都能显著简化网络配置管理流程。

记住,技术工具的价值在于如何运用。v2rayng提供了强大的功能,但真正的力量在于用户如何根据自己的需求灵活组合这些功能。希望本指南能帮助您更好地驾驭这款工具,在数字世界中畅行无阻。

随着您对v2rayng同步功能的深入理解和熟练应用,您会发现网络管理不再是负担,而是一种可以轻松掌控的日常操作。这正是技术应该带来的体验——复杂于内,简单于外,让生活更轻松,让连接更自由。